I'd go with the ASRock for 1 reason. The M.2 slot is on the front of the mobo. With that Giga board, the M.2 slot is on the backside of the board, pinched between the mobo and mobo tray, so airflow will be about nonexistent. M.2's have a hard enough time with heat without complicating things.
